建站优化

当前位置:

宽度搜索的原理是什么,搜索引擎的搜索原理是什么

浏览量:95次

宽度搜索的原理是什么,搜索引擎的搜索原理是什么

很多网友不明白宽度搜索的原理是什么,搜索引擎的搜索原理是什么的相关内容,今天小编为大家整理了关于这方面的知识,让我们一起来看下吧!

宽度搜索的原理是什么?

宽度搜索(BFS,Breadth-First Search)是一种图搜索算法,用于在一个图数据结构中寻找某个节点到其他节点的最短路径。宽度搜索的原理是按照层级遍历的方式逐层访问节点,直到找到目标节点或者遍历完所有节点。

宽度搜索的过程中,首先将起始节点加入待访问队列中,并标记为已访问。接着从队列中取出一个节点,并访问它的相邻节点。如果相邻节点未被标记为已访问,则将其加入队列,并标记为已访问。不断重复这个过程,直到队列为空或找到目标节点。如果找到目标节点,则可以通过回溯确定到达目标节点的最短路径。

搜索引擎的搜索原理是什么?

搜索引擎的搜索原理是通过索引技术和排名算法实现的。首先搜索引擎会爬取互联网上的网页,并对这些网页进行分析和处理,构建索引。索引是一个包含了关键词与网页的映射关系的数据库,它提供了快速的查询接口。

当用户在搜索引擎输入关键词时,搜索引擎会根据关键词从索引中找到相关的网页。搜索引擎会根据一定的算法对这些网页进行排名,以便将最相关的网页展示给用户。排名的算法考虑了多个因素,包括关键词出现的频率、关键词在网页中的位置、网页的权重等。

搜索引擎还会提供搜索建议和搜索纠错功能。搜索建议是根据用户输入的关键词,搜索引擎会给出一些相关的关键词建议,以提供更准确的搜索结果。而搜索纠错功能则是在用户输入的关键词存在拼写错误时,搜索引擎会自动纠正关键词,并给出相关的搜索结果。

好了,有关宽度搜索的原理是什么,搜索引擎的搜索原理是什么的内容就为大家解答到这里,希望能够帮助到大家,有喜欢的朋友请关注本站哦!

[声明]本网转载网络媒体稿件是为了传播更多的信息,此类稿件不代表本网观点,本网不承担此类稿件侵权行为的连带责任。故此,如果您发现本网站的内容侵犯了您的版权,请您的相关内容发至此邮箱【779898168@qq.com】,我们在确认后,会立即删除,保证您的版权。